Winterblessed Annie

Senna set off to search for the Aurora, only to encounter the child, Annie, outside her estate. Her most cherished friend was her family's pet bear, who recently died. Annie wished for Polaris to bring him back to life, but Senna refused, and instead presented the bear in toy form. "Loss is a part of life, but his memories will live inside this gift.

Picked up Winterblessed Annie from a chest last month and wasn't expecting much since I usually rock Hextech or Super Galaxy. After around 50 games though, this skin's become my go to when I need to pop off in ranked.

The Q feels way more responsive than base Annie, especially when you're last hitting under tower and need that instant cast. Her ult drop has this frosty explosion that's actually easier to see in river fights compared to other Annie skins where Tibbers just kinda appears. But what really sells it is the E shield animation being cleaner without all the swirling particles that Galaxy Annie has. During a baron fight yesterday, I could actually track my positioning better while kiting backwards because the shield effect doesn't clutter your screen. The passive stun indicator sits perfectly above her model too, making it obvious when you're charged up without being obnoxious like some of her older skins.

Is Winterblessed Annie worth it? Probably not pay to win levels but there's definitely clarity advantages here. The W cone is super visible which helps both you and enemies understand the hitbox better, and honestly that's saved me from inting a few times when I thought I was in range but wasn't. Compared to other Annie skins at 1350 RP, this one hits different because everything just flows smoother. My experience with Winterblessed Annie convinced me that newer skins really do feel better mechanically, not just visually. If you're an Annie main who wants something that won't tilt you with weird animations or unclear ability ranges, this is worth grabbing next time it's in your shop.
